As there exist certain skin conditions and diseases which can cause hair loss one of the first things you should do if you are experiencing beyond normal hair loss is consult with a dermatologist. He or she will be able to tell you if you have a skin condition, or if the hair loss is caused by something else. Knowing is half the battle.

Consider having a hair transplant to correct your hair loss. This procedure is performed by a specialist, usually on men who are older than 35. Hair follicles from the back of the head are surgically removed and implanted in the bald areas. Although it is costly, hair transplants provide a permanent natural looking solution to this vexing problem.

If you play football, make sure that your helmet is not too tight. Tight fitting helmets can strain your scalp and weaken each strand of hair. Limit the amount of hair that you lose by wearing a helmet that fits comfortably.

Hair loss and thinning can happen to women as well as men. This type of balding occurs with aging and can start in the 20’s and 30’s. Female hair loss can be successfully treated if it is due to common disorders such as thyroid disease and anemia, among others.

See your doctor. Before resigning yourself to thinning hair, consult with your primary care physician. There are numerous conditions from hypothyroidism to vitamin deficiencies that could be the cause of your hair loss. If the hair loss is due to an underlying condition, treating the condition is often enough to restore hair growth.

If you are worried about hair loss, look to your current hairstyle. Hair clips, barrettes and tight ponytails have been linked to hair loss. This kind of hair is loss is called traction alopecia.

When people experience hair loss, one of the most common culprits is using hair dryers. Too much hair drying at high temperatures can damage the hair structure, resulting in excessive hair loss. Some remedies are to blow dry the hair less often and towel or air dry instead.

To prevent thinning hair, treat your hair gently. People who treat their hair with chemicals frequently over a long period of time, such as with coloring, perming and straightening, can cause damage to their hair that makes it more likely to break, which makes it thinner. If you do use harsh treatments on your hair, try to spread them out over time to minimize the damage.
